Russian aristocrats bred these hounds during the 16th century for hunting wolves and other game across vast open terrain. Their speed and sight-hunting abilities were prized among nobility.
Developed in Sussex, England during the 1800s for hunting in dense undergrowth. These dogs specialized in methodical, thorough game flushing through challenging terrain.
